- The distance between Tuckerton, Nj, Usa and Mutsu, Japan is approximately 10,329 km or 6,419 mi.
- To reach Tuckerton, Nj in this distance one would set out from Mutsu bearing 26.7° or NNE and follow the great circles arc to approach Tuckerton, Nj bearing 154.1° or SSE .
- Tuckerton, Nj has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a) whereas Mutsu has a marine west coast climate (Cfb).
- Tuckerton, Nj is in or near the warm temperate moist forest biome whereas Mutsu is in or near the cool temperate wet forest biome.
- The mean temperature is 2.8 °C (5°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 0.6 °C (1.1°F) more in Tuckerton, Nj. The continentality subtype is subcontinental for both.
- Total annual precipitation averages 153.3 mm (6 in) less which is equivalent to 153.3 l/m² (3.76 US gal/ft²) or 1,533,000 l/ha (163,888 US gal/ac) less. About 7/8 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 1.7° higher in Tuckerton, Nj than in Mutsu.
